The Trump Administration is pushing the US toward a Constitutional showdown in the SCOTUS over First Amendment protections and the right of Freedom of Assembly and Freedom of Speech, and very possibly even Freedom of Religion.  As much as I believe that this administration is on the right path on a number of issues, there are others - like this - that cause me concern.

I fully expect a number of these so-called "illegal protests" on campuses as well as deportations of green card holders to end up in front of the Supreme Court.  As a First Amendment absolutist, I may not agree with the protests, but I support "the right of the people peaceably to assemble, and to petition the government for a redress of grievances."

Whether Left or Right, no matter what the excuses are to attempt to infringe on the First Amendment protections, whether woke activists or MAGA nationalists - the First Amendment is sacrosanct and Inviolable. 

However, I'm not particularly sure how masking for anonymity can be protected under the Constitution, nor do I support masking in order to conceal one's identity while protesting.  I've been in protests during the Vietnam War and even with feds on the roofs taking pictures, we'd just smile and shoot them a Peace Sign.  ☮️ 🕊️✌️

For those who failed to take Civics in school or who are not US Citizens:

Amendment I
Congress shall make no law respecting an establishment of religion, or prohibiting the free exercise thereof; or abridging the freedom of speech, or of the press; or the right of the people peaceably to assemble, and to petition the government for a redress of grievances.
